A Dark Dragon

A Dark Dragon is a best selling text MUD RPG game which begins in a dark room. This is a game that RPG fans should not miss.
The adventure begins with the Dark IslandThe secret of the dark forest ...A story full of tension will unfold.The fate of the dark island is depending on you. Let's start the game right now.

The game takes some part of story from A Dark Room originally published in 2013 on the web by Doublespeak Games.

Rad. R. Sep 13, 2019     

A very innovative and addictive game! It can best be described as a mix between an RPG and a management game. You build and manage a small community of people in order to generate resources to be used for exploratory RPG-style expeditions.
